Apply for Business Loan with a Co-applicant. Another effective way to secure a business loan without producing your income tax returns is by taking the help of a co-applicant. You can apply for a business loan with any of your earning family members with valid proof of income as a co-borrower or co-applicant.

KEY TAKEAWAYS. A no doc home equity loan allows you to qualify for a home equity loan using alternative income verification methods. No doc home equity loans are best for self-employed individuals, freelancers, and small business owners because they can qualify based on assets and bank statements instead of W-2s, tax returns, or pay stubs.The Bank Statement Loan programs allow self-employed individuals to receive a home loan without using tax returns, W2’s, and pay stubs. Bank Statement Loan programs use the total deposits in your bank account are used to calculate the income over a 12 to 24 month period, with your bank statements they determine if you …Web

If no tax return was filed, the taxpayer’s W-2 and 1099 statements and/or the last pay stub can be used to complete the FAFSA. If the taxpayer is self-employed, a signed statement confirming the amount of adjusted gross income may be used. Additionally, if the taxpayer requested an extension …

Bank statement loans are a type of mortgage that lenders can issue based on personal information and bank statements rather than tax returns and employer verification. They can be a good option if you work for yourself, own a business, or don't have a steady income.
